A.Landlord does not have any authority to provide any address proof which can be taken as concrete apart from signing a rental agreement. The letter issued by a landlord is a supplemental document to enhance the residential proof.
I don't think the passport officials are going to accept the letter or statement issued by the landlord as conclusive proof or residence.
